Victorian Ventnor given modern safety solution

Island Roads say work in Belgrave Road, Ventnor, is seeking to make the road safer while preserving the town’s special character.

They are replacing the section of parapet damaged in a road traffic incident late last year. The challenge has been to come up with a design that complements the surrounding street-scene, that lies in a Conservation Area, but that is strong enough to prevent a similar incident happening again.

A solution, agreed after consultation with the IW Council’s Conservation Officer, has been to install traditional-looking cast iron bollards reinforced by steel inserts that are far more in keeping with Ventnor’s charm but at the same time will prevent vehicles leaving the road and going over the top of the retaining wall. The original cast iron parapet was too badly damaged to be repaired, but a new one of similar appearance will be installed as a pedestrian restraint.
